It really depends on the size of the yellows and what they are eating. If they are willing to eat the heavy line then that's what I would prefer to throw at them but that's not always the case. So here's the break down.

(YoYo Jig, suface iron, live mackeral/sardines or squid)
Calstar (optional seeker) 670 or 610 with a Penn 4/0 Narrow AKA yellowtail special with 40lb Andy line.


(surface iron, live mac/sardine/squid)
calstar grafighters (6480 or even a 6480L good alternatives) 800M with a Newell 332 (P-Series prefered but not a must also Penn 500 a good alternative),with 25- 30lb (Andy) line.


(Macs, Squid, Sardines, anchovies)
Calstar 800L (270/8H a very good alternative) with a Newell 229 or 300(P-Series prefered but not a must also Penn 501 good alternative),with 20lb Andy line. This would be the rod to use when the yellows are line shy and when the fish are shy a floralcarbon leader might be what it takes to put one on the hook.


If I had my choice I would choose the 40lb set up because I would always go with the heaviest line the yellows will are willing to eat however, for local fishing the middle is probably going to be more practical because it can be used for a wider range of local fishing where as the first set up is one that you would use more for fishing offshore or when the yellows break wide localy and they're eating the heavier string.
